use标签使用fill
时间: 2023-09-25 14:06:15 浏览: 53
### 回答1:
可以使用 `fill` 属性为 `use` 标签指定填充颜色。例如:
```html
<svg width="100" height="100">
<use xlink:href="#icon" fill="red" />
<symbol id="icon" viewBox="0 0 100 100">
<circle cx="50" cy="50" r="40" />
</symbol>
</svg>
```
在上面的示例中,`use` 标签引用了 `symbol` 标签中的图标,并设置了填充颜色为红色。注意,`fill` 属性只对具有非透明填充的图形有效,例如圆形、矩形等。如果要为 `path` 标签指定填充颜色,需要使用 `fill` 属性或 `fill` 样式。
### 回答2:
使用<fill>标签可以将文本内容缩放到适合的区域内,以便更好地显示在屏幕上。它可以放在任何 HTML 元素的内部。
使用<fill>标签最常见的情况是在使用CSS设置背景图像时,可以通过将图像放在<fill>标签内,使其自动铺满整个元素的背景,不出现图像重复的情况。在设置背景图像时,可以使用<fill>标签来保持图像比例,以便完整地显示整个图像,并且不会使图像变形或截断。
另外,<fill>标签还可以用于视频和音频元素中,可以通过设置<fill>标签来调整媒体的大小,使其自动适应父元素的大小。这在创建响应式网页时非常有用,因为可以根据不同屏幕大小自动调整媒体的大小,以便更好地适应不同设备。
总的来说,<fill>标签是一种非常有用的HTML标签,可以用于调整元素内部内容的大小,使其适应不同的屏幕和设备,并且保持原始内容的比例,以确保更好的展示效果。
### 回答3:
Use标签中的fill属性是用来填充元素的内容的。通过设置fill属性,我们可以指定元素的内容被填充的方式和填充的内容。
fill属性有三种取值方式:
1. color:fill可以接受一个颜色值作为参数,用于指定填充的颜色。比如,可以设置fill="red"来将元素的内容填充为红色。
2. pattern:fill还可以接受一个pattern作为参数,用于指定用于填充的图案。比如,可以设置fill="url(#pattern-id)"来引用一个预定义的图案。
3. gradient:fill还支持渐变填充。比如,可以设置fill="url(#gradient-id)"来引用一个渐变填充。
使用fill属性可以实现一些有趣的效果。比如,可以用fill属性来给图形元素填充颜色,用于区分不同的区域。也可以利用fill属性来添加纹理或者渐变效果,使得图形看起来更加生动和立体。
总之,fill属性是用来指定元素内容填充方式的。通过设置fill属性,可以选择填充的颜色、图案或者渐变。使用fill属性可以为图形元素添加颜色、纹理或者渐变效果,从而提升元素的视觉效果。